Steak & Cheese boats

I use Steakumms (but use that or any other frozen sandwich steak meat.)

brown 3 or 4 sections of the frozen meat in a pan with diced onions for flavor.
salt and pepper to taste.
melt provolone cheese on top. ( i use two slices)
serve on romaine lettuce "boats"
top with mayo, jalapeno's, a little ketchup, and/or mustard.
add bacon if u like

Mexican Salad
 
Here's a recipe for my easy homemade Mexican Salad. I can't call it a taco salad because of course we know taco shells and tortilla chips have lots of carbs. With this salad, it's all the taste without the carbs!

Instructions

In a frying pan cook a pound of ground beef or turkey.
Drain meat and add 1 taco seasoning packet.
Let simmer until seasoning thickens into a sauce.
Remove from heat and top with shredded cheese.
Slice onions and green peppers and brown them in a frying pan.

Build your salad anyway you'd like using:
Sour Cream
1/3 cup of chunky Pico de Gallo (Salsa)
Jalapeno's peppers to taste.

I always build my salad by putting the onions and green peppers on the bottom, then adding ground beef and cheese, next pile on the lettuce, and top with salsa, sour cream and, jalapeno's.

Serves two.

Prep time 20 mins
Cook time 15 mins

Fried string cheese

i got the idea from http://www.genaw.com/lowcarb/fried_string_cheese.html


but i rolled it in some bacon grease first and then coated it with parmesan cheese. it was the only way to get the grated parm to stick to the string cheese. butter would probably work too.
